Output 3528a2860e01c80ecd8384c6a33ea0f2ee2f4e178ed1ecdafd7377baf880f6fb:0

value
159112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 395dd7833fbe280df146b20c6d393d0b14302e34 OP_EQUAL
address
36vLriwQeBidmmqVh4hfTAhzy1X5cAwmUh
transaction
3528a2860e01c80ecd8384c6a33ea0f2ee2f4e178ed1ecdafd7377baf880f6fb
spent
true